The Importance of Flowers in Japanese Culture

Flowers have traditionally been used in Japan to express feelings that cannot be expressed. Through the concept of Hanakotoba (the language of flowers), each bloom conveys a special meaning. The fleeting beauty of life is symbolized by cherry blossoms, while chrysanthemums stand for joy and permanence.

This symbolism makes flower gifting an art form. A carefully chosen bouquet shows that you’ve not only thought of the recipient but also respected the traditions that flowers represent. This sensitivity is what makes gifting flowers in Japan a uniquely meaningful act.

Popular Occasions for Gifting Flowers

Flowers are suitable for nearly every milestone in Japan. Birthdays, weddings, and anniversaries are obvious choices, but blooms also hold significance during seasonal festivals such as Hanami, when cherry blossoms are celebrated.

Corporate culture also embraces flowers. Orchids are a popular congratulatory gift for business achievements, while lilies or peonies may be offered for academic success. Each event is enhanced by the thoughtful presence of flowers, adding grace and beauty to the occasion.

Choosing the Perfect Bouquet

Selecting flowers in Japan requires both creativity and awareness. Romantic occasions may call for roses or lilies, while professional settings often favor orchids or chrysanthemums. Seasonal bouquets are always admired, reflecting Japan’s appreciation of nature’s cycles.

When choosing, it’s wise to consider cultural sensitivities. For example, white chrysanthemums are typically reserved for funerals, so they should be avoided in joyful contexts. By understanding these nuances, your bouquet becomes not only beautiful but also appropriate.

2. Which flowers are most meaningful in Japan?
Cherry blossoms, chrysanthemums, lilies, orchids, and peonies are widely cherished for their cultural symbolism.

3. Are there flowers I should avoid?
Yes. White chrysanthemums and lilies are associated with funerals, so they should not be sent for celebrations.
